Bosquesur Viewpoint

Highlight • Viewpoint

El Mirador de Bosquesur, located in the large Bosquesur Peri-urban Forest Park, is a 15-hectare elevated area built on the recovery of the old Leganés landfill. It offers panoramic views of the area and is a key point for hiking and cycling in southern Madrid.
Key details of the area:
Location: It extends along the Culebro stream, covering the municipal areas of Leganés, Fuenlabrada, Getafe, and Pinto.
El Mirador: The viewpoint area includes reforestation with native Mediterranean vegetation and serves as an ecological corridor.
Routes: It is very popular for walking and cycling. The circular route from Fuenlabrada (passing through the El Naranjo neighborhood or the La Serna and Parque Polvoranca Cercanías stations) is about 7 km long and is easy.

Convent of Santa María de la Cruz

Highlight • Religious Site

This monastery was one of the richest in Castile during the 15th century, later it was looted during the independence war in the 19th century and destroyed during the civil war. Today it is still active and rebuilt.

The route to the Teja fountain is a fairly flat route, without much unevenness, and it is one of the most popular destinations for runners — ideal for training. The fountain is an old cattle watering hole where you can take a break. Next to the fountain is the Hermitage of San Isidro, built as a cave, taking advantage of the mountainside.

Frequently Asked Questions

What historical sites can I visit around Torrejón De La Calzada?

The area offers several historical landmarks. You can explore the 18th-century Church of San Cristóbal, the historic Fuente de la Peñuela, and the Casa Consistorial in the Plaza de España. Another significant site is the Convent of Santa María de la Cruz, a rebuilt 15th-century monastery that was once one of Castile's wealthiest. Further afield, you can find the Torreón de Pinto, a medieval tower with a rich history, known for imprisoning figures like the Princess of Éboli.

What cultural sites are there in Torrejón De La Calzada?

Beyond historical landmarks, Torrejón De La Calzada features the Casa de la Cultura, notable for its original Neomudéjar architecture from the late 20th century. This cultural center serves as an important hub for community activities and events, reflecting the town's artistic and social life.

What is the oldest building in Torrejón De La Calzada?

The oldest building in the municipality is the Church of San Cristóbal, an 18th-century church that remains a prominent feature of the urban landscape and a key historical landmark in Torrejón De La Calzada.
